Understanding the Symbolism of Crying in Dreams

Crying, in the context of dreams, isn’t always a direct reflection of sadness. Sometimes, it represents a release of pent-up emotions, both positive and negative. This emotional release can be cathartic and signifies a necessary shedding of burdens, allowing for personal growth and transformation. Your subconscious mind might be processing complex feelings through this symbolic act of crying in your sleep.

The intensity of the crying, the setting, and the emotions associated with it in the dream all play a crucial role in deciphering its meaning. A gentle weep might differ significantly from a gut-wrenching, uncontrollable sob. Consider the environment and who is present in the dream for a comprehensive analysis.

Different Types of Crying Dreams

Crying Tears of Joy

Crying Tears of Joy

Dreaming about crying tears of joy suggests a feeling of overwhelming happiness and relief. This could be related to a recent accomplishment, a positive change in your life, or the resolution of a long-standing problem. The dream is a reflection of your subconscious mind celebrating your successes and acknowledging positive emotions.

The intensity of your joy in the dream could denote the magnitude of positive emotions in your waking life. Pay attention to the details of the dream; they may provide clues to the source of your happiness.

Perhaps you were reunited with a loved one, reached a major milestone, or experienced an unexpected stroke of good fortune. These are all potential triggers for joyous crying dreams. Exploring these feelings further in your waking life offers significant self-awareness.

Crying Tears of Sadness

Conversely, dreaming of crying tears of sadness often reflects emotional distress or unresolved issues in your waking life. It might indicate feelings of grief, loss, disappointment, or even fear. The dream acts as a safe space to process these difficult emotions.

However, remember that it doesn’t necessarily mean a major tragedy is eminent. The dream could be highlighting minor stressors or anxieties you might be inadvertently neglecting. Addressing these in waking life can help you resolve the underlying emotional distress.

Consider journaling your feelings, talking to a trusted friend or therapist, or engaging in self-care activities to help alleviate the negative emotions. Understanding where the sadness stems from is crucial.

Crying Uncontrollably

If you dream of crying uncontrollably, it often suggests feeling overwhelmed by emotions. You might be struggling to cope with a situation in your waking life. The dream is a manifestation of the lack of control you feel in your daily existence.

It suggests a profound need to acknowledge and process these overwhelming emotions. This can often mean seeking support from others, or perhaps finding healthy outlets for the pent-up stress.

Look for patterns in your waking life that are contributing to this intense sense of overwhelm. Recognizing these patterns is the first step towards regaining a sense of control.

Crying Silently

Dreaming of crying silently, on the other hand, could indicate suppressed emotions. You might be bottling up feelings, avoiding confrontation, or neglecting your emotional needs. The silent crying reflects a subconscious desire to express emotions that you are actively avoiding in your waking life.

It’s a call to acknowledge those repressed feelings and find healthier ways of expressing them. Consider exploring journaling or therapy, or simply engaging in honest communication with loved ones.

Addressing these suppressed emotions is important for your emotional health. Silent crying in a dream is a signal to break down those emotional barriers.

Crying in Public

Dreaming about crying in public can symbolize vulnerability and a fear of judgment. You might be feeling exposed or insecure about a certain aspect of your life. Such dreams could indicate a need to examine your self-perception and interpersonal relationships.

This vulnerability might also indicate a desire for connection and empathy. It’s possible you need to reach out to others for support or seek validation in some aspect of your life.

The public setting emphasizes the potential for external judgment, or a fear of not being accepted for who you are. This dream encourages you to examine this fear in the context of your waking reality.

The Context of Your Dream: Who, What, Where?

The context of your dream is critical in interpreting its meaning. Who were you with? What was the setting? What triggered the crying? Consider the details of your dream to gain a deeper understanding of the underlying emotions.

For example, crying while alone might indicate internal struggles, while crying with loved ones suggests a need for support and connection. The setting, too, may provide important clues to the dream’s interpretation. A familiar setting may reflect a current situation in your waking life. An unfamiliar setting might represent an unknown situation or challenge.

The trigger for the crying in the dream is equally important. What event or situation caused you to start crying? This details often points to the source of the emotional distress or joy in your waking life. Analyzing these details carefully is essential for a comprehensive understanding of the dream’s meaning.
